Applications of Wood Waste Recycling for Wood Chips
At our Probark facility, wood chips find numerous applications, such as:
- Root System Coverage:
Enhance the health of your gardens by using wood chips as a protective cover for plant and shrub root systems. - Mulch Creation:
Turn excess wood into mulch, which helps in retaining soil moisture and suppressing weed growth. - Compost Production:
Wood chips can also be a part of the composting process, enriching your soil with essential nutrients.
